Ausstellungsbesuch: Die Donauinsel im Wien Museum
Ausstellungsbesuch: Die Donauinsel im Wien Museum
For English scroll down. Die Donauinsel – zwischen 1972 und 1988 gemeinsam mit der Neuen Donau erbaut, um Wien endgültig vor verheerenden Hochwässern zu schützen – ist heute aus dem Stadtbild nicht mehr wegzudenken. Dass an warmen Sommertagen auf der mehr als 21 Kilometer langen und bis zu 250 Meter breiten Insel einmal mehr als 200.000 Personen täglich unterwegs sein würden, war beim politischen Startschuss für das Projekt im Jahr 1969 allerdings weder geplant noch vorhersehbar. Ursprünglich als rein technisches Hochwasserschutzprojekt konzipiert und politisch höchst umstritten, entwickelte sich die Donauinsel erst im Lauf von mehr als 30 Jahren Planungs- und Bauzeit zu einem vielfältigen Natur- und Erholungsraum am Wasser. Die Ausstellung im Wien Museum beleuchtet die Geschichte und Gegenwart dieser besonderen Landschaft, die heute zu den wichtigsten Freiräumen in der Stadt zählt und Stadtbewohner:innen unterschiedlichsten Alters und diversester Herkunft für eine Vielzahl von Aktivitäten dient. Unter vielen anderen Objekten sind ein elf Meter langes historisches Donauinsel-Modell, ein mobiler Inselkiosk sowie aktuelle Foto- und Filmarbeiten von Klaus Pichler, Elodie Grethen und Dariusz Kowalski zu sehen. Wir treffen uns um 15:00 Uhr vor dem Eingang des Wien Museum, Karlsplatz 8, 1040 Wien. Jeden 1. Sonntag im Monat ist der Eintritt in die Sonderausstellungen des Wien Museum kostenlos. Nach dem Ausstellungsbesuch gehen wir in eines der nahegelegenen Cafés. ***English:*** The Danube Island – built between 1972 and 1988 along with the New Danube to protect Vienna from devastating floods – has become an integral part of the city’s identity. Back in 1969, when the project was launched, no one imagined that more than 200,000 people would spend beautiful summer days on this stretch of land, 13 miles long and up to 800 feet wide. What began as a purely technical and highly controversial flood-control project gradually transformed over more than 30 years of planning and construction into a diverse natural and recreational space on the water. The Wien Museum exhibition explores both the history and present of this extraordinary landscape, which today is one of Vienna’s most important open spaces. The island is used by residents of all ages and backgrounds for countless activities. Among many other objects, a 36-foot-long historic model of the Danube Island, a food cart, as well as recent photographic and film works by artists Klaus Pichler, Elodie Grethen, and Dariusz Kowalski are on display. We meet at 3. p.m. at the entrance of the Wien Museum, Karlsplatz 8, 1040 Wien. On the first Sunday of every month, admission to the Wien Museum’s special exhibitions is free. After visiting the Exhibition we will have a drink together in a café nearby.

Stop Guessing: How to Measure and Improve LLM Outputs
Stop Guessing: How to Measure and Improve LLM Outputs
Most people use LLMs by feel: ask a question, read the answer, decide whether it “seems good,” and move on. That works for casual use. It does not work when you are building software, automating workflows, writing important documents, or relying on AI for anything that needs to be repeatable. In this talk, we’ll look at how to improve and evaluate the inputs and outputs of LLMs using practical measurement techniques. We’ll cover how prompt changes affect results, how to compare outputs, how to build simple evaluation sets, and how math-based methods like similarity scoring can help you move beyond guesswork. This will be beginner-friendly, so even if you don't know anything about AI, you should get something out of it. However, this will be a little more technical than our intro talks. You do not need to be an AI researcher, but programmers and technically curious attendees will get a lot out of it. We’ll cover: * Why “it looks good” is not enough * How to improve prompts by changing the input, context, and constraints * How to compare LLM outputs more systematically * Basic evaluation techniques for accuracy, consistency, and usefulness * How embeddings, cosine similarity, and scoring can help evaluate results * Where automated evaluation works — and where humans still need to stay in the loop By the end, you’ll have a practical mental model for treating LLMs less like magic and more like systems you can test, measure, and improve.
